Matt, I've committed your patch in revision 1569015, can you check?

Before we mark this issue as resolved, what are your thoughts on naming things for OSGi?
I noticed that in this patch, the two submodules have artifactIds {{log4j-to-slf4j-bundle}} and {{log4j-slf4j-impl-bundle}}, ending in "bundle". I actually kind of liked the convention(?) we had before where the word "osgi" was in the artifactId.

What about using this as the naming rule for OSGi sub-modules and artifactIds?
||submodule||artifact Id||
|log4j-osgi/moduleName<-optionalBundleName>|log4j-osgi-moduleName<-optionalBundleName>|

So for the core bundles we have a bunch of sub-bundles, if there is only one osgi bundle per module we just use the module name. From the current osgi submodule names I would like to remove the word "osgi" (as they are all already submodules of the log4j-osgi module), and for the artifactIds I would like to prefix all of them with {{log4j-osgi}}. By giving them a common prefix, all resulting jar files are automatically grouped more clearly than when their names end in the {{bundle}} suffix.

> The bundle "Apache Log4j SLF4J Binding" (2.0.0.beta8) has an unresolved dependency to the package org.slf4j which is exported by the slf4j-api bundle. The Slf4j-api bundle has also an unresolved dependency to the package org.slf4j.impl which is exported by the bundle "Apache Log4j SLF4J Binding". Without the slf4j-api everything works. But the Slf4j-api bundle is needed because of given dependencies of third-party-bundles. The "Apache Log4j SLF4J Binding" bundle should also export the package org.slf4j.
